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Autumn Snowflake | balloon aeolis |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Plantae (Plants)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) | Mollusca (Mollusks) |
| Class | Liliopsida (Monocots) | Gastropoda (Gastropoda) |
| Order | Asparagales (Asparagales) | Nudibranchia (Nudibranchia) |
| Family | Amaryllidaceae | Eubranchidae |
| Genus | Acis | Eubranchus |
| Species | Acis autumnalis | Eubranchus exiguus |
